Critical Skills for Life and Leadership presents a new paradigm for advancing the human intellect. In this groundbreaking work, Ryan Kueter demonstrates how specific critical skills enable people to be more effective in performing their life roles. To do that, the author combines current science with his own theories and original ideas to connect the dots between a variety of disciplines and answer complex questions related to personal development, organizational management, mental health, motivation, and many others.
